Transaction 22532edc91fec5d7aac5557610e936f8849081e477c74da285055100aeca4683
1 Input
1 Output
-
22532edc91fec5d7aac5557610e936f8849081e477c74da285055100aeca4683:0
- value
- 257160
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a750e010108fe467877fd9f7a4c9afa0772adc8
- address
- bc1q4f6suqgpprlyv7rhlk0h5ny6lgrh9twg4awy8l